Has a 1st round QB bust ever found a home on a new team? by hellomynameisdoug in nfl

[–]HumanHorseshoe 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Feel like Jay Cutler is definitely the strongest case.

Pretty crazy that prior to Baker/Goff this year - Cutler & Tannehill are probably the only two examples that positively contributed to their 2nd+ teams after the team who drafted them moved on (I’m discounting Vick due to circumstance, and Stafford/Palmer bc rebuild =! move on)

How much longer does the list get back if you go back into the 80s/90s? Bledsoe is the only example that immediately comes to mind
